    2. BODY {font-family: Arial; font-size: 10pt;} A possible explanation for website link problems. When someone using AOL creates a link - it becomes a clickable link to anyone else using AOL. It is usually blue or red and underlined. However, if the receiver is not using AOL then he sees a "double" non-clickable link. this is what it looks like. HREF="http://www.DavenportFamily.1colony.com">http://www.DavenportFamily.1co lony.com</A> The receiver need to copy and paste only the part in quotes and don't include the quotes. This one starts with "http" and ends in ".com" What I do, as an AOL user, is to include a ">" in front of the address to prevent AOL from interpreting it as an address. In that way it doesn't create the link the AOL way. If I know my message is only going to an AOL user I do it the normal way. Here is an example: >http://www.DavenportFamily.1colony.com Link I just created in the AOL method - <A href="http://www.DavenportFamily.1colony.com"> http://www.DavenportFamily.1colony.com</A> Hope this helps.
